c18ab0df77f95fc605c382cc5ec4e7c9.json 11 KB

1
  1. {"remainingRequest":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\babel-loader\\lib\\index.js!D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\cache-loader\\dist\\cjs.js??ref--0-0!D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\vue-loader\\lib\\index.js??vue-loader-options!D:\\wnmp\\www\\vue\\seaBlueAdmin\\src\\component\\common\\CallInLocation.vue?vue&type=script&lang=js&","dependencies":[{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\src\\component\\common\\CallInLocation.vue","mtime":1678954023464},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\babel.config.js","mtime":1681371897685},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\cache-loader\\dist\\cjs.js","mtime":1681371913603},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\babel-loader\\lib\\index.js","mtime":1681371912860},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\cache-loader\\dist\\cjs.js","mtime":1681371913603},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\vue-loader\\lib\\index.js","mtime":1681371925849}],"contextDependencies":[],"result":[{"type":"Buffer","data":"base64:Ly8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KaW1wb3J0IEZvb3RlclBhZ2UgZnJvbSAiQC9jb21wb25lbnQvY29tbW9uL0Zvb3RlclBhZ2UiOwppbXBvcnQgeyBnZXRBbGxTdG9yYWdlTG9jYXRpb24sIGdldEFyZWFEYXRlQnlTa3VJZCB9IGZyb20gIkAvYXBpL1N0b2NrIjsKZXhwb3J0IGRlZmF1bHQgewogIG5hbWU6ICJDbGllbnRMaXN0TW9kYWwiLAogIGNvbXBvbmVudHM6IHsvLyBGb290ZXJQYWdlLAogIH0sCiAgcHJvcHM6IHsKICAgIGlzU2hvdzogewogICAgICB0eXBlOiBCb29sZWFuLAogICAgICBkZWZhdWx0OiBmYWxzZQogICAgfSwKICAgIGlzQ2hlY2s6IHsKICAgICAgdHlwZTogQm9vbGVhbiwKICAgICAgZGVmYXVsdDogdHJ1ZQogICAgfSwKICAgIHdhcmVob3VzZUlkOiB7CiAgICAgIHR5cGU6IFtOdW1iZXIsIFN0cmluZ10sCiAgICAgIGRlZmF1bHQ6IDAKICAgIH0sCiAgICBza3VJZDogewogICAgICB0eXBlOiBbTnVtYmVyLCBTdHJpbmddLAogICAgICBkZWZhdWx0OiAwCiAgICB9LAogICAgbWF0ZXJpZWxJZDogewogICAgICB0eXBlOiBbTnVtYmVyLCBTdHJpbmddLAogICAgICBkZWZhdWx0OiAwCiAgICB9CiAgfSwKCiAgZGF0YSgpIHsKICAgIHJldHVybiB7CiAgICAgIHRhYmxlRGF0YTogW10sCiAgICAgIGNob29zZV9kYXRhOiBbXSwKICAgICAgcHJlX3BhZ2U6IDEwLAogICAgICBwYWdlOiAxLAogICAgICB0b3RhbDogMCwKICAgICAgbG9hZGluZzogZmFsc2UsCiAgICAgIHBhZ2VMYXlvdXQ6ICJ0b3RhbCwgcHJldiwgcGFnZXIsIG5leHQiLAogICAgICBhcmVhSWQ6ICIiLAogICAgICBhcmVhX2xpc3Q6IFtdCiAgICB9OwogIH0sCgogIGNyZWF0ZWQoKSB7CiAgICB0aGlzLmdldEFyZWFEYXRlQnlTa3VJZCgpOyAvLyB0aGlzLmdldEFsbFJlc2Vydm9pcigpOwogIH0sCgogIG1ldGhvZHM6IHsKICAgIGFzeW5jIGdldEFyZWFEYXRlQnlTa3VJZCgpIHsKICAgICAgY29uc3QgewogICAgICAgIGRhdGEsCiAgICAgICAgcGFnZVRvdGFsCiAgICAgIH0gPSBhd2FpdCBnZXRBcmVhRGF0ZUJ5U2t1SWQoewogICAgICAgIHdhcmVob3VzZUlkOiB0aGlzLndhcmVob3VzZUlkLAogICAgICAgIHNrdUlkOiB0aGlzLnNrdUlkLAogICAgICAgIGJhc2ljR29vZHNJZDogdGhpcy5tYXRlcmllbElkCiAgICAgIH0pOwoKICAgICAgaWYgKGRhdGEubGVuZ3RoKSB7CiAgICAgICAgdGhpcy50YWJsZURhdGEgPSBkYXRhWzBdLmFyZWFEYXRlOwogICAgICB9CiAgICB9LAoKICAgIC8vIOaQnOe0ouWJjemhteaVsOWPmDEKICAgIHNlYXJjaENsaWNrKCkgewogICAgICB0aGlzLnBhZ2UgPSAxOwogICAgICB0aGlzLmdldEFyZWFEYXRlQnlTa3VJZCgpOwogICAgfSwKCiAgICBzZWxlY3Rpb25DaGFuZ2UodmFsKSB7CiAgICAgIGlmICghdGhpcy5jaG9vc2VfZGF0YS5sZW5ndGgpIHsKICAgICAgICB0aGlzLmNob29zZV9kYXRhID0gdmFsOwogICAgICB9IGVsc2UgewogICAgICAgIHRoaXMuY2hvb3NlX2RhdGEgPSB0aGlzLiRfY29tbW9uLnVuaXF1ZSh0aGlzLmNob29zZV9kYXRhLmNvbmNhdCh2YWwpLCBbImlkIl0pOwogICAgICB9CiAgICB9LAoKICAgIGNvbmZpcm0oKSB7CiAgICAgIHRoaXMuY2FuY2VsKCk7CiAgICAgIHRoaXMuJGVtaXQoImNvbmZpcm0iLCB0aGlzLmNob29zZV9kYXRhKTsKICAgIH0sCgogICAgLy8g5Y+M5Ye76YCJ5oupCiAgICBkYlNlbGVjdChyb3cpIHsKICAgICAgdGhpcy5jaG9vc2VfZGF0YSA9IFtyb3ddOwogICAgICB0aGlzLiRlbWl0KCJjb25maXJtIiwgdGhpcy5jaG9vc2VfZGF0YSk7CiAgICAgIHRoaXMuY2FuY2VsKCk7CiAgICB9LAoKICAgIC8vIOWFs+mXreW8ueeqlwogICAgY2FuY2VsKCkgewogICAgICB0aGlzLiRlbWl0KCJjYW5jZWwiKTsKICAgIH0sCgogICAgLy8g5pS55Y+Y6aG15pWwCiAgICBwYWdlQ2hhbmdlKHZhbCkgewogICAgICB0aGlzLnBhZ2UgPSB2YWw7CiAgICAgIHRoaXMuZ2V0QXJlYURhdGVCeVNrdUlkKCk7CiAgICB9LAoKICAgIHNpemVDaGFuZ2UodmFsKSB7CiAgICAgIHRoaXMucHJlX3BhZ2UgPSB2YWw7CiAgICAgIHRoaXMucGFnZUNoYW5nZSgxKTsKICAgIH0gLy8gIOivt+axguW6k+WMuuWIl+ihqAogICAgLy8gYXN5bmMgZ2V0QWxsUmVzZXJ2b2lyKCkgewogICAgLy8gICBjb25zdCBkYXRhID0gYXdhaXQgZ2V0QWxsUmVzZXJ2b2lyKHsKICAgIC8vICAgICBwYWdlOiAxLAogICAgLy8gICAgIHBhZ2VTaXplOiA5OTksCiAgICAvLyAgICAgd2FyZWhvdXNlSWQ6IHRoaXMud2FyZWhvdXNlSWQsCiAgICAvLyAgIH0pOwogICAgLy8gICB0aGlzLmFyZWFfbGlzdCA9IGRhdGEuZGF0YTsKICAgIC8vIH0sCgoKICB9Cn07"},{"version":3,"mappings":";;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;AA4EA;AACA;AACA;EACAA,uBADA;EAEAC,aACA;EADA,CAFA;EAKAC;IACAC;MACAC,aADA;MAEAC;IAFA,CADA;IAKAC;MACAF,aADA;MAEAC;IAFA,CALA;IASAE;MACAH,sBADA;MAEAC;IAFA,CATA;IAaAG;MACAJ,sBADA;MAEAC;IAFA,CAbA;IAiBAI;MACAL,sBADA;MAEAC;IAFA;EAjBA,CALA;;EA2BAK;IACA;MACAC,aADA;MAEAC,eAFA;MAGAC,YAHA;MAIAC,OAJA;MAKAC,QALA;MAMAC,cANA;MAOAC,sCAPA;MAQAC,UARA;MASAC;IATA;EAWA,CAvCA;;EAwCAC;IACA,0BADA,CAEA;EACA,CA3CA;;EA4CAC;IACA;MACA;QAAAX;QAAAY;MAAA;QACAf,6BADA;QAEAC,iBAFA;QAGAe;MAHA;;MAKA;QACA;MACA;IACA,CAVA;;IAWA;IACAC;MACA;MACA;IACA,CAfA;;IAgBAC;MACA;QACA;MACA,CAFA,MAEA;QACA,wCACA,4BADA,EAEA,MAFA;MAIA;IACA,CAzBA;;IA0BAC;MACA;MACA;IACA,CA7BA;;IA8BA;IACAC;MACA;MACA;MACA;IACA,CAnCA;;IAoCA;IACAC;MACA;IACA,CAvCA;;IAwCA;IACAC;MACA;MACA;IACA,CA5CA;;IA6CAC;MACA;MACA;IACA,CAhDA,CAiDA;IACA;IACA;IACA;IACA;IACA;IACA;IACA;IACA;;;EAzDA;AA5CA","names":["name","components","props","isShow","type","default","isCheck","warehouseId","skuId","materielId","data","tableData","choose_data","pre_page","page","total","loading","pageLayout","areaId","area_list","created","methods","pageTotal","basicGoodsId","searchClick","selectionChange","confirm","dbSelect","cancel","pageChange","sizeChange"],"sourceRoot":"src/component/common","sources":["CallInLocation.vue"],"sourcesContent":["<!--选择库区库位列表弹窗-->\n<template>\n <el-dialog\n title=\"库区库位\"\n :close-on-press-escape=\"false\"\n :close-on-click-modal=\"false\"\n :visible=\"isShow\"\n width=\"50%\"\n @close=\"cancel\"\n >\n <!-- <el-form size=\"small\" inline>-->\n <!-- <el-form-item>-->\n <!-- <el-select-->\n <!-- v-model=\"areaId\"-->\n <!-- filterable-->\n <!-- style=\"width: 100%\"-->\n <!-- placeholder=\"请选择所属库区\"-->\n <!-- >-->\n <!-- <el-option-->\n <!-- v-for=\"item in area_list\"-->\n <!-- :key=\"item.id\"-->\n <!-- :label=\"item.name\"-->\n <!-- :value=\"item.id\"-->\n <!-- ></el-option>-->\n <!-- </el-select>-->\n <!-- </el-form-item>-->\n <!-- </el-form>-->\n <el-table\n ref=\"warehouseTable\"\n v-loading=\"loading\"\n :data=\"tableData\"\n size=\"small\"\n @row-dblclick=\"dbSelect\"\n @selection-change=\"selectionChange\"\n >\n <el-table-column\n prop=\"storageLocationId\"\n label=\"ID\"\n min-width=\"140px\"\n ></el-table-column>\n <el-table-column\n prop=\"areaName\"\n label=\"所属库区\"\n min-width=\"140px\"\n ></el-table-column>\n <el-table-column\n prop=\"storageLocationName\"\n label=\"所属库位\"\n min-width=\"140px\"\n ></el-table-column>\n <el-table-column\n prop=\"num\"\n label=\"商品数量\"\n min-width=\"140px\"\n ></el-table-column>\n <el-table-column label=\"选择\">\n <template slot-scope=\"scope\">\n <el-button\n icon=\"el-icon-check\"\n size=\"mini\"\n @click=\"dbSelect(scope.row)\"\n ></el-button>\n </template>\n </el-table-column>\n </el-table>\n <!-- <FooterPage-->\n <!-- :page-size=\"pre_page\"-->\n <!-- :total-page.sync=\"total\"-->\n <!-- :current-page.sync=\"page\"-->\n <!-- @pageChange=\"pageChange\"-->\n <!-- @sizeChange=\"sizeChange\"-->\n <!-- ></FooterPage>-->\n </el-dialog>\n</template>\n\n<script>\n import FooterPage from \"@/component/common/FooterPage\";\n import { getAllStorageLocation, getAreaDateBySkuId } from \"@/api/Stock\";\n export default {\n name: \"ClientListModal\",\n components: {\n // FooterPage,\n },\n props: {\n isShow: {\n type: Boolean,\n default: false,\n },\n isCheck: {\n type: Boolean,\n default: true,\n },\n warehouseId: {\n type: [Number, String],\n default: 0,\n },\n skuId: {\n type: [Number, String],\n default: 0,\n },\n materielId: {\n type: [Number, String],\n default: 0,\n },\n },\n data() {\n return {\n tableData: [],\n choose_data: [],\n pre_page: 10,\n page: 1,\n total: 0,\n loading: false,\n pageLayout: \"total, prev, pager, next\",\n areaId: \"\",\n area_list: [],\n };\n },\n created() {\n this.getAreaDateBySkuId();\n // this.getAllReservoir();\n },\n methods: {\n async getAreaDateBySkuId() {\n const { data, pageTotal } = await getAreaDateBySkuId({\n warehouseId: this.warehouseId,\n skuId: this.skuId,\n basicGoodsId: this.materielId,\n });\n if (data.length) {\n this.tableData = data[0].areaDate;\n }\n },\n // 搜索前页数变1\n searchClick() {\n this.page = 1;\n this.getAreaDateBySkuId();\n },\n selectionChange(val) {\n if (!this.choose_data.length) {\n this.choose_data = val;\n } else {\n this.choose_data = this.$_common.unique(\n this.choose_data.concat(val),\n [\"id\"]\n );\n }\n },\n confirm() {\n this.cancel();\n this.$emit(\"confirm\", this.choose_data);\n },\n // 双击选择\n dbSelect(row) {\n this.choose_data = [row];\n this.$emit(\"confirm\", this.choose_data);\n this.cancel();\n },\n // 关闭弹窗\n cancel() {\n this.$emit(\"cancel\");\n },\n // 改变页数\n pageChange(val) {\n this.page = val;\n this.getAreaDateBySkuId();\n },\n sizeChange(val) {\n this.pre_page = val;\n this.pageChange(1);\n },\n // 请求库区列表\n // async getAllReservoir() {\n // const data = await getAllReservoir({\n // page: 1,\n // pageSize: 999,\n // warehouseId: this.warehouseId,\n // });\n // this.area_list = data.data;\n // },\n },\n };\n</script>\n\n<style scoped>\n .search-wrp {\n padding: 15px 0;\n }\n</style>\n"]}]}